Sliema council budgets €1.66 m income for financial year 2026
Sliema Local Council's signed 2026 annual budget plans €1,658,940 in income and €1,637,525 in spending, projecting a €21,415 surplus, with operations and community works the largest outlays.

Sliema Local Council has published its signed Annual Budget for Financial Year 2026. The Overview and Summary page carries the signatures of Mayor John Pillow and Executive Secretary Pierre Paul Portelli. The document was uploaded to the council site in March 2026, ahead of the year-end 2025 Quarter 4 financial report.
The Statement of Income and Expenditure budgets total income of €1,658,940 and total expenditure of €1,637,525, for a projected surplus of €21,415. That income figure is €46,583 higher than the €1,612,357 income line in the 2025 annual budget. The increase is entirely from central government funding, budgeted at €1,341,940 for 2026 (€1,321,940 under section 55 of Cap. 363 and €20,000 under section 58). Bye-law income is held at €260,000 (€225,000 from permits and €35,000 from community services), Local Enforcement System income at €7,000, and other contributions at €50,000.
On spending, personal emoluments are budgeted at €294,114, down €23,308 on the 2025 budget total of €317,422, with employees' salaries and wages set at €201,512 and the mayor's allowance at €22,055. Operations and maintenance rise to €1,080,910, and administration to €178,560. Within operations, the largest 2026 lines include community spending at €257,000, road and street cleaning at €220,000, repairs and upkeep at €170,000, parks and gardens cleaning and maintenance at €100,000, contract and project management at €71,500, street lighting at €66,000, and bulky refuse collection at €58,410.
The cash budget projects €1,658,940 of inflows and €1,553,584 of outflows, an annual cash surplus of €105,356, lifting the carried cash balance from €1,998,046 to €2,103,402. The Financial Situation Indicator is budgeted at 73%. Net assets and retained funds are projected at €1,871,000 by 31 December 2026.
